Faroe Islands vs Turkey Betting Odds, Tips, Predictions, Preview 25th September 2022

Faroe Islands welcome Turkey for a clash in the UEFA Nations League at Torsvoellur Stadium this coming Sunday. The last time these two teams squared up, Turkey ran out 4-0 winners which they surely won't mind doing again at Torsvoellur Stadium.
Faroe Islands are number 3 in the table on five points after five matches. Turkey rank as number 1 with 13 points after five matches played.
Faroe Islands are taking on number 42 in the FIFA world ranking, Turkey, with the home side sitting as number 125.
Faroe Islands only average a modest one goals per game in their last five matches in this tournament, in which they scored five goals. They also conceded nine for an average of 1.8 per game. They failed to keep their opponents from scoring.
Ahead of their coming UEFA Nations League match, Turkey look in excellent goal-scoring shape. In their previous five games, they hammered in an average of 3.4 goals a game. A highly respectable total of 17 goals, while also letting in three goals. The latter leaves an average of 0.6 per outing, in which they managed four clean sheets.

Faroe Islands vs Turkey Team News
Turkey seem to have only one player on the injured and absent list, when they travel to Torsvoellur Stadium to face Faroe Islands.
Salih Oezcan won't be travelling with Turkey this time, as he nurses an injury.
